Update from February 23, 9:50 p.m.:

First freezing frost, then sunshine and the most pleasant spring weather: within a few days, the weather in Germany has turned a real record.

Weather in Germany: Historical temperature rise - More than 40 degrees within a week

Climate researchers from the German Meteorological Service have now made an interesting calculation: According to them, the temperature has never - since the beginning of the recordings - risen as sharply within seven days as can be read from the confirmed readings from a weather station in Göttingen.

While a low of exactly minus 23.8 degrees was measured there on February 14th, the high on February 21st was 18.1 degrees.

All in all, this results in an increase of 41.9 degrees.

In order to find anything even remotely comparable, the scientists had to go far back in time: to May 1880, to be precise, the early days of weather records.

The previous record was set there.

At that time, a temperature increase of 41 degrees was measured within seven days, reports a spokesman for the German Weather Service (DWD).

Weather in Germany: Spring stays - lots of sun and pleasant temperatures

In northern Germany, two regional heat records were already measured on Monday: In Quickborn in Schleswig-Holstein the maximum value was 18.9 degrees and was thus above the record value of 17.8 degrees measured two years earlier.

In Hamburg, even 21.1 degrees were measured at the Neuwiedenthal weather station on Monday.

"For the first time since the beginning of temperature recordings, the temperature in Hamburg has risen above 20 degrees in winter," said the DWD spokesman.

The next few days will continue like spring in Germany: with lots of sun and warm temperatures of up to 20 degrees during the day - and light frost at night.

According to forecasts by the DWD, there will only be a small setback in the weather on Friday.

There it gets rainy and cloudy in many places in Germany.

Weather in Germany: dust cloud on the way to Europe - health consequences threaten

Update from February 19, 6:23 p.m

.: A sand and dust cloud from the Sahara is expected to reach Europe at the weekend.

"Plumes of dust from the desert can cause red skies, restricted visibility or stains on cars and windows from dust deposits," said Mark Parrington of the EU Earth observation program Copernicus on Friday.

Based on the wind forecasts, a spread from southern Europe to Norway is possible.

Because of the high concentrations of dust and sand particles, a deterioration in air quality and the associated health consequences are possible.

The cloud can probably be seen in the sky with the naked eye.

A cloud of dust had already darkened the sky in parts of Western Europe in February and caused the particle concentration to rise "a hundred times" higher than usual in many places.

Update from February 18, 2:18 p.m

.: The winter is counted!

This weekend the spring starts - in some regions of Germany with up to 20 degrees.

Mind you, plus 20 degrees.

“From the last weekend to the upcoming one, we have to deal with a temperature jump of 34 degrees.

That is very remarkable, ”says Alban Burster, meteorologist at

wetter.com

.

In the north and south-east, according to weather expert Burster, spring is still a little hesitant.

But on Sunday at the latest, spring will give its first guest appearance in all of Germany in 2021.

Subtropical warm air flows unhindered to us in Germany.

Two high pressure areas over Eastern and Southern Europe and a strong low pressure area over the Atlantic form a kind of corridor for this warm air, explains Burster.

The downside of the weather: "The sudden rise in temperature literally explodes the vegetation - much to the suffering of many allergy sufferers," warns the meteorologist.

An increased exposure to alder pollen can already be expected.

Hazel pollen is also already on the way.

Update from February 15, 3:22 p.m.:

Despite the risk of black ice in large parts of Germany, there was no new traffic chaos with major closures on Monday.

The railway also reported only a few disruptions on Twitter by the afternoon.

Because of the ice warnings, lessons were canceled in numerous regions of Lower Saxony.

There was a cold record in Marienberg-Kühnhaide.

In the place in the Ore Mountains near the Czech border, low temperatures of at least -29 degrees prevailed during the night.

Kachelmannwetter reported this on Twitter and spoke of the coldest night of winter.

Since Kühnhaide does not belong to the monitoring network of the German Weather Service (DWD), Dachwig in Thuringia was the coldest place in Germany with minus 23.3 degrees on Monday night.
